Verifiable Parental Consent

VATSIM does not accept memberships from children under age 13 without consent of a parent. VATSIM makes every effort to verify ages of minors at registration. If a child under the age of 13 wishes to participate in VATSIM, a printed Consent Form is required to be signed and mailed in by the parent to VATSIM according to the instructions on the Consent Form.

Children's Participation in Forums

VATSIM shall make every attempt to prohibit newsgroup/forum posting by children under the age of 13. Posting restrictions are placed on the membership ID of any member who is below the age of 13.

Children's Participation in Online Chat

Due to the nature of participation in the simulation, the use of online chat is prevalent within the VATSIM context. VATSIM shall make every attempt to prohibit children under the age of 13 from participating in these venues without verifiable parental consent. Login restrictions are placed on the membership ID of any member who is below the age of 13 and has not verifiable parental consent.
